Product Description

Specification

Output power:50/100/150W
Wavelength: 755/808/1064±10nm
Bar quantity :1/2/3 Pcs
Bar interval:1.6mm
Light size: 12*9 mm X mm
Working current :45~50A
Working voltage:1.8/3.6/5.4V
Duty cycle: 40%
Pulse width:Duty cycle:*1000/Hz ms
Frequency: 1~5 Hz
Cooling Method: Fan heat dissipation
Fan parameter: DC5.0V,40*40*20t,7200rpm
Air volume: 7.6 CFM
Ambient temperature: -10℃~28℃(Continuous operation 30min) ℃
Operation temperature: -109C~45C(Strict control)℃

Vertical and Horizontal diode laser stacks and two-dimensional arrays, with power into the multi-kW range, for pumping, directed energy, hair removal, and materials processing.

Continuous Wave (CW) Stacks - microchannel cooling and uses it to enable optimum thermal management at high powers.
Pulsed Stacks - Covering QCW to long pulse conditions with conduction cooling and tap-water cooling options.
Broadest Wavelength Range - The range from 638 nm up to 2200 nm includes all major solid-state and fiber laser pump wavelengths as well as wavelengths used for defense, materials processing and medical aesthetics.
